Felder und Institutionen. Der soziologische Neo-Institutionalismus und die Perspektiven einer praxistheoretischen Institutionenanalyse

.
Berliner Journal für Soziologie, 18 (1): 129--155 (May 2008)
DOI: 10.1007/s11609-008-0007-6

Abstract

The rise of new institutionalism in American sociology and its quest for a theoretical foundation has improved attention to Bourdieu’s theory of practice. The article examines chances of a combination of new institutionalism and practice theory as well as prospects of a practice-theoretical analysis of institutions. With some exceptions, it is revealed that neither in theory nor in empirical research Bourdieu’s theory of practice is properly considered by new institutionalism. Nevertheless, fruitful connections between new institutionalism and practice theory are identified especially with regard to basic problems of institutional analysis: the ambiguity of the concept of rule and the delimitation of social institutions as a sociological object of research.
